Output 105e025aac883a03a879c1d7dea0cdbe183b39b2811a8d7e19df84210e0fe786:36
- value
- 76675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8126c1dbf82f906627b03837cd0b479a33d18a8a OP_EQUAL
- address
- 3DTuXC58tHauh3JGcXwbRTwfSs2stMA5EF
- transaction
- 105e025aac883a03a879c1d7dea0cdbe183b39b2811a8d7e19df84210e0fe786